Working within the Earth & Environment team the primary focus for the Director of Water Resources includes project delivery and direction, provision of technical expertise in water resources engineering design, business development, understanding and maintaining our key client relationships, training and mentoring of junior staff and active development of new client relationships and opportunities in line with our strategy. This role is predominantly within the mining business, with the potential to also work with other local sectors, including infrastructure and land development.
Key Responsibilities
- Provide senior technical direction, review, and sign-off of work within your area of professional practise;
- Deliver practice-leading consulting services to internal and external clients in the areas of conceptual model development, hydraulics, engineering design, mine water management, stormwater management, flood-lines, hydrology, water conservation and demand management, water balances and mine water management;
- Direct and review water resource aspects of a range of international mining and water resources projects, including environmental assessments, environmental permitting, and engineering design projects;
- Climatic, hydrological, and hydraulic assessments, including fieldwork, data management, data analysis, and modelling;
- Integrated water management plans and completing conceptual design of water management infrastructure;
- Water balance modelling to assess water management solutions and to estimate water demand, treatment, storage, and discharge volumes;
- Pre-feasibility, feasibility and detailed designs of water management infrastructure (e.g. open channels, sewers, culverts, spillways, energy dissipators, holding and settling ponds, pumping systems) including capital and operating cost estimates;
- Dam break analyses of water and tailings dams, including developing inundation maps, delineating self-rescue zones and classifying dams in terms of risk to population, property and the environment;
- Dilution and assimilative capacity assessments of surface water receivers of effluent;
- Assist with developing projects and services which support climate change reporting, resilience and adaptation, including nature-based solutions;
- Participate in and direct multi-disciplinary project teams on local, regional and international consulting projects;
- Manage and grow a team of water resources professionals across Canada; and
- Manage business financial KPIs to meet Ausenco metrics.
